About this listen

February 1869. Washington D.C. The 40th Congress is about to adjourn. One final year remains in the most tumultuous decade in United States history. A shattered nation tries to forge ahead, yet devastating memories of a civil war and the turmoil it caused still haunt those left in its wake.

Mathew Brady knows a thing about that war, as does Alexander Gardner. The two pioneering cameramen set out to bring the war home to America’s doorstep as had never been done before. They paid witness, from the heady days on the summer fields at Bull Run to the horrors of Antietam and Gettysburg, following their beleaguered Commander-In-Chief as he led the Union on to Richmond. During these short remaining winter days of Congress,

Brady and Gardner have just submitted competing petitions asking the government to purchase their own collection of war negatives. They are driven to preserve their work for posterity, lest the restless country forget its painful past or the cameramen who preserved it.
